AMD to launch HD 7970 before Christmas




/ 12 years ago

In a move that is very surprising to many AMD has pushed forward the launch date of the HD 7970 to December the 22nd from the 9th of January 2012. The HD 7970 is the highest performance single GPU card AMD will produce on the HD 7000 series generation and a 2011 launch would certainly be a big marketing win for the AMD team. Although it will only be a ‘paper-launch’  or in other words only reviewers will get their hands on samples and be able to publish reviews, customers won’t be able to get stock till the previous launch date of January the 9th.

The earlier date means add in board partners such as ASUS, Gigabyte and MSI can show off their custom designs of the HD 7970 at CES 2012. The HD 7950 still retains the same January the 9th launch date. Although all specifications and reviews will be available now 2 weeks before stock is meaning that customers have plenty of time to make an educated decision about whether the HD 7970 is the card for them especially when the speculated price tag is around £450/€500 which is more than a GTX 580.
